About This Item
London: Thomas Nelson, 1961 A comprehensive account of the railways of Scotland from the time of their initial construction up to the early 1960s.
x, 230pp with colour and black and white plates. Dust jacket has some edge wear, now in a protective sleeve.

About Wadard Books PBFA
The shop of Wadard Books is located in a listed 17th century timber framed building in the historic Kentish village of Farningham. The business is named after Wadard, one of Farningham's Domesday landlords, a henchman of Bishop Odo and featured on the Bayeaux tapestry.
